Caroline Matilda Earle was born in 1774 in Pacolet Valley, Spartanburg, South Carolina, USA, the child of John Earle And Thomasine Prince. Caroline Matilda Earle married Edwin Hannon. Caroline Matilda Earle passed away in 1815 in , Rutherford, North Carolina, Usa.
